Abstract

一种集成电路和用于测量距离的系统。该集成电路(10)包括:发射器(11),被配置为发射测距信号;信号输入通道(12)和基于开关电容阵列的信号采样电路(13),信号输入通道(12)被配置为向信号采样电路(13)传递测距信号的回波信号对应的模拟电信号,信号采样电路(13)被配置为对模拟电信号进行采样,并存储模拟电信号的采样信号;模数转换电路(14),被配置为对信号采样电路(13)存储的采样信号进行模数转换,以生成用于指示回波信号接收时间的数字电信号。基于开关电容阵列的信号采样电路(13)可以利用开关电容阵列存储采样信号,因此模数转换电路(14)无需实时地对采样信号进行模数转换,降低了系统对模数转换电路(14)转换速率的要求。
